Nurudeen Orelesi Admits Chornomorets Will Be A Tough Nut To Crack
Published: August 22, 2013
Ahead of the Europa League meeting with Chornomorets on Thursday evening, Skënderbeu Korçë midfielder Nurudeen Orelesi has reacted to speculations linking him with a summer exit from the Albanian Super League champions.
'' We are before an important match in Europe and I think that nobody wants distraction by commenting, neither the president.
'' I am not aware of these facts and do not believe there is anything concrete. For me now it is important to perform well in Europe,'' the ex Flying Eagle told panorama - sport.com.
Orelesi , 24 , admitted that Chornomorets will be a tough nut to crack , but they are capable of giving the Ukrainians a run for their money in Odessa.
He told the Albanian newspaper : '' It will be a very hard match, but we are prepared to give the maximum. - spiritually, physically and tactically.
'' It will be a match, which will define our destiny in Europe. Ukrainians are a tough team.
'' They have eliminated Cervena Zvezdën, but the Serbian team is not one known to all.
'' Meanwhile, we played in the Champions League, where we eliminated Neftçi Baku, a team that has managed to play in the Europa League group stage last season.''
